I enjoyed this dish made by my sister's mother-in-law, and asked for the recipe to share here. I like how simple it is, and the fact that the tofu is dried lends a much smokier, flavorful taste than fresh tofu.
Recipe Ingredients:
8 oz dried tofu, thinly sliced
3/4 to 1 lb of chinese chives or flowering chinese chives cut into 1.5 in segments
soy sauce (to taste)
salt (to taste)
cooking oil
Recipe Steps:
Heat cooking oil in a stir fry pan. Add the dried tofu slices and soy sauce (start off with about 1 tablespoon). Stir so the pieces are coated with soy sauce and until the tofu looks a bit soft and browned. Set aside on a plate.
Add the chopped chives in the same pan, and fry until wilted. Add salt to taste.
